Oakfield Primary School is a primary school in Scunthorpe for ages 3 to 11. It is one of the 90 schools in North Lincolnshire. It ranks 3rd of 27 primary schools in Scunthorpe. Its latest Ofsted rating is Good, from an inspection in October 2022.

What Ofsted said
From the inspection on 5 October 2022
There is a strong sense of family at Oakfield Primary School. Staff and pupils look after each other because they care. Each morning, families gather in the playground and speak warmly with each other and members of staff. Pupils say that bullying is rare, but that if it does happen, staff deal with incidents quickly. Pupils learn how to look after their mental health and to share concerns through the 'talk buddy' system. Pupils are polite and courteous and move around the school in an orderly manner. Pupils have warm relationships with staff. Leaders have high expectations of all pupils. Children in early years settle into school and learn routines quickly. They enjoy a wide range of activities and learn how to work with others. Parents and carers of children in early years say that their children thrive. Over time, pupils develop the ability to reflect wisely on issues such as equality of opportunity. Older pupils intelligently discuss the qualities needed for healthy relationships. They have a strong understanding about different faiths and can speak with clarity about the make-up of different families. Pupils love the different opportunities that challenge them to develop their broader skills. These include being a school librarian, reading to younger pupils, and being prefects and play leaders. Pupils enjoy a range of trips, clubs and experiences. Pupils say that this helps them to learn more in different subjects.
What the school should improve
- The checks on pupils' learning in a minority of wider curriculum subjects are not as helpful as those seen in core subjects. This means that teachers do not always have the right information about what pupils have learned long term. Leaders should clearly define their assessment approach so that pupils continue to build on prior learning with success.
